一種基于稀疏矩陣的多核并行擾碼方法
1.1 基于稀疏矩陣的多核并行擾碼
基于稀疏矩陣的多核并行擾碼結(jié)構(gòu)如圖2所示。基于稀疏矩陣的并行擾碼生成器產(chǎn)生了偽隨機(jī)序列q,且同時(shí)輸出序列q中N個(gè)相鄰的偽隨機(jī)碼。此外,輸入信號b(i)經(jīng)過串/并轉(zhuǎn)換后得到N路并行信號,然后分別送入對應(yīng)序號的處理器核,在單個(gè)處理器核內(nèi),生成的偽隨機(jī)碼與輸入信號進(jìn)行模二加運(yùn)算,得到輸入信號的擾碼輸出;最后,并行擾碼輸出經(jīng)過并/串轉(zhuǎn)換得到串行擾碼輸出d(i)。本文引用地址:http://www.ex-cimer.com/article/155094.htm
圖2中q(i)表示偽隨機(jī)序列的第i個(gè)元素;k為非負(fù)整數(shù);加法器表示模二加運(yùn)算,則第i時(shí)刻擾碼輸出d(i)的數(shù)學(xué)表達(dá)式為:
d(i)=b(i)⊕q(i) (1)
從圖2及式(1)可以看出,基于稀疏矩陣的并行擾碼生成器是加擾,解擾過程中的重要組成部分。接下來詳細(xì)介紹如何實(shí)現(xiàn)基于稀疏矩陣的并行擾碼生成器。
假設(shè)并行擾碼生成器輸出的偽隨機(jī)序列q為m序列,則q可由r級線性反饋移位寄存器產(chǎn)生,且其循環(huán)周期L=2r-1。r級線性反饋移位寄存器的生成多項(xiàng)式可寫為:
式中c(n)取值為0或1。
以式(2)作為生成多項(xiàng)式,圖3給出了相應(yīng)的r級線性反饋移位寄存器結(jié)構(gòu)。
圖中,q(i)表示第i時(shí)刻生成的偽隨機(jī)碼;fn代表寄存器;cn代表乘法器,加法器表示模二加運(yùn)算,則i時(shí)刻的線性反饋移位寄存器狀態(tài)為:
Fi=[f1i,f2i,…,fri]T (3)
下一時(shí)刻,線性反饋移位寄存器的狀態(tài)為:
評論